Output 0d4dccc681454b20c689bcc03e7b246748216e7c19f37e20fcebc163a3f673aa:0

value
4917100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02b8580f28dcd69a28ab1de12250a85920f5f9f5 OP_EQUAL
address
31wQ7NWw7piSXVjshaPo57voBqwYj71tBU
transaction
0d4dccc681454b20c689bcc03e7b246748216e7c19f37e20fcebc163a3f673aa
confirmations
150171
spent
true